    The Apostle Paul wrote this second epistle to Timothy — his son in the faith — while imprisoned in Rome. Timothy’s mother and grandmother taught him the Old Testament Scriptures from his childhood (2 Timothy 3:15).   3. Aug 9, 2022 · Show thyself approved means to present yourself to God in such a way that you receive His approval. Followers of Jesus Christ and especially pastors and teachers are to work persistently to understand and explain the truth of God’s Word correctly.
